Garlic Parmesan Chicken and Potatoes Recipe

Description

This Garlic Parmesan Chicken and Potatoes recipe features tender bite-sized chicken pieces and crispy roasted baby potatoes tossed in a flavorful blend of paprika, poultry seasoning, and black pepper, then combined with garlic butter and a rich garlic parmesan wing sauce. Finished with melted mozzarella cheese, this dish is a savory, comforting meal perfect for weeknight dinners.


Ingredients

Units Scale

Chicken

  • 1 pound chicken tenderloins or bre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ons paprika
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ons poultry se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/2 cup garlic parmesan wing sauce
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ella

Potatoes

  • 1 pound baby potatoes, halved
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ons paprika
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ons poultry se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at the oven to 400°F and prepare a baking sheet for roasting the potatoes.
  2. Prepare Chicken: Trim any fat off the chicken and cut into bite-sized pieces. Place in a large bowl, drizzle with 1 tablespoon olive oil.
  3. Prepare Potatoes: In a separate large bowl, add the halved baby potatoes and 1 tablespoon olive oil.
  4. Mix Seasoning: In a small bowl, combine paprika, poultry seasoning, and black pepper.
  5. Season Chicken and Potatoes: Sprinkle half of the seasoning mixture evenly over the chicken and the other half over the potatoes. Toss both to coat evenly.
  6. Roast Potatoes: Spread the seasoned potatoes evenly on the baking sheet and roast in the oven for 20 minutes until golden and tender.
  7. Cook Chicken: While potatoes roast, he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the seasoned chicken and cook for 7-10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until browned on all sides and fully cooked through.
  8. Add Butter and Garlic: To the cooked chicken in the skillet, add butter and minced garlic. Stir to combine and c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
  9. Combine Chicken and Potatoes: Add the roasted potatoes from the oven to the skillet with the chicken. Toss everything together off the heat.
  10. Add Sauce: Pour the garlic parmesan wing sauce over the chicken and potatoes. Toss to coat evenly.
  11. Melt Cheese: Sprinkle shredded mozzarella evenly over the top of the mixture. Cover the skillet with a lid and let the cheese melt for about 5 minutes over low heat.

Notes

  • Use chicken breast pieces or tenderloins according to preference. Tenderloins cook slightly faster and are more tender.
  • Ensure potatoes are halved evenly for even roasting.
  • Covering with a lid helps melt the cheese thoroughly and keeps the dish moist.
  • Adjust seasoning amounts to taste.
  • For a crispier potato texture, you can roast them a few minutes longer before combining with chicken.
